    Quote Originally Posted by DonBiase View Post
    What would be a good price on 30 06 M2 Ball?
    And I will carry a notebook and a map.
    Quote Originally Posted by bogey1 View Post
    Wouldn't pay over 50cents a round. I think thats still high
    Quote Originally Posted by ScotsGuards View Post
    It depends if the .30.06 is US M-2 ball or other surplus. US M-2 ball is commanding .70+ cents a round. Foreign surplus somewhat less. Oddly enough one might find a deal on PPI or some such just now.
    Haha - good luck finding any M2 ball at $0.50/rd.

    Realistically, USGI ball goes for around $0.80-0.90/rd, while HXP goes for around $0.70-0.80/rd.

    ScotsGuard is dead on - M2 milsurp is expensive to the point, I can pretty much find PPU for cheaper.

    Suffice to say, if you do find M2 ball under $0.70 - SNAG IT

    Quote Originally Posted by Mdoravec View Post
    I’ve been to Oaks several times but never took a firearm in for trade or sell? I’m taking in a Taurus pt 24/7 .40. Does anyone know what the procedure is? Do I have to have trigger locked at law enforcement check in at the door? Thanks
    They will put a cable tie on it as you come in. When a dealer wants to look at it he will likely remove it,and may or may not replace it. I usually grab a spare or two from the door folks to put one on to keep people happy.
